一、上线作业的定义与重要性
上线作业,顾名思义,是指将软件、系统或服务从开发或测试环境迁移到生产环境的过程。这一过程对于确保产品稳定运行、提升用户体验至关重要。在数字化时代,上线作业的效率和安全性直接影响到企业的竞争力。
二、上线作业的关键步骤
1.准备阶段
在上线作业之前,首先要进行充分的准备工作。这包括但不限于:
-确定上线时间:选择一个低峰时段进行上线,以减少对用户的影响。
制定上线计划:明确上线作业的流程、时间表和责任人。
数据备份:对生产环境中的关键数据进行备份,以防万一。2.测试阶段
上线前,必须对系统进行全面的测试,以确保新功能或修复的稳定性。测试阶段包括:
-单元测试:对单个模块进行测试,确保其功能正确。
集成测试:将各个模块组合在一起进行测试,确保它们之间能够正常交互。
系统测试:对整个系统进行测试,确保其满足业务需求。3.上线阶段
上线阶段是整个作业中最关键的部分,包括以下步骤:
-部署:将开发或测试环境中的代码、配置文件等部署到生产环境。
配置:根据生产环境的需求,对系统进行相应的配置。
监控:上线后,实时监控系统运行状态,确保其稳定运行。4.回滚与优化
上线后,如果发现问题,需要及时进行回滚。回滚步骤如下:
-确定问题:分析问题原因,确定是否需要回滚。
回滚操作:将系统恢复到上线前的状态。
优化:针对问题进行优化,提高系统性能。三、上线作业的注意事项
1.安全性:确保上线过程中不泄露敏感信息,防止恶意攻击。
2.可靠性:选择合适的上线工具和流程,提高上线作业的可靠性。
3.透明度:上线作业的进度和结果应向相关人员及时通报。
4.沟通:与开发、测试、运维等团队保持密切沟通,确保上线作业顺利进行。上线作业是确保软件、系统或服务稳定运行的关键环节。通过以上步骤和注意事项,可以有效地提高上线作业的效率和安全性,为用户提供更好的服务体验。在数字化时代,上线作业的重要性不言而喻,企业应给予足够的重视。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。